Kimberley's Big 8 Tourist Attractions

In the process of identifying tourist attractions in Kimberley, the emphasis falls time and again on the historical importance of the architecture of old Kimberley. The compactness of Kimberley means that many of the historical sites can be experienced through a number of walks and driving tours. These can be undertaken with a qualified local guide or on your own using the descriptions provided in our tourist walks and routes pages.
Kimberley is proud to be one of the most authentic historical destinations in South Africa. Because of the finding of diamonds as far back as the 1870s, Kimberley soon emerged as one of the first major towns in South Africa. This economic and political turmoil resulted in the emergence of many famous people.  
Listed below are what we consider to be the Big 8 Tourist Attractions for visitors to Kimberley and the surrounding area, providing something to suit everyone's taste. Please enjoy our little 'taster' as you plan your trip to the diamond fields.
  • Big Hole Mine Museum
  • Duggan Cronin Gallery
  • Magersfontein Battlefield Museum
  • McGregor Museum
  • Transport and Aviation Museums
  • Wildebeest Kuil Rock Art Centre
  • William Humphreys Art Gallery (WHAG)
  • Wonderwerk Cave
